The London Academy of Excellence Tottenham (LAET), an academic sixth form in the heart of Tottenham, is looking to appoint an Academic Coach in Maths and Further Mathematics for a September 2026 start. Supported by Tottenham Hotspur and Highgate School, LAET benefits from ample resources to ensure that all students can overcome socio-economic barriers and flourish. This includes access to extra academic support, but also extends to the wellbeing and welfare of our students.
LAE Tottenham opened in September 2017 and has more than 800 students on roll as of September 2025. It is an academically selective 16-19 free school harnessing the support of nine independent schools to offer unrivalled educational opportunities to the most ambitious and motivated 16-19 year olds from Haringey and beyond.
The successful candidate will academically inspire our students and help them flourish in their A-level years and beyond. The role would suit a recent graduate with a passion for social mobility who is interested in education, academia and/or working with young people. The position serves as a good springboard for a career in teaching, academia or social work and public policy, and could be done alongside postgraduate study.

LAE Tottenham
Academically selective Sixth Form, opened in September 2017. Results in the top 2% nationally for attainment and progress.
Principal Education Sponsor Highgate School and Lead Business Sponsor Tottenham Hotspur Football Club.
Partnered by eight other leading independent schools - Alleyn’s, Chigwell, Haberdashers’ Aske’s Boys’, Harrow, John Lyon, North London Collegiate, Mill Hill and St Dunstan’s College, each offering departmental support
